Transaction c8d7430b323f4788217949d561ea15675ffdf2be53ca24cb77d618d0852af321
1 Input
2 Outputs
- c8d7430b323f4788217949d561ea15675ffdf2be53ca24cb77d618d0852af321:0
- c8d7430b323f4788217949d561ea15675ffdf2be53ca24cb77d618d0852af321:1
value 133780200
address 1M2pvscQKAboZTKeRXjznzPUL5x3CN8VaW
value 5994888345
address 1EKWbdFEL1cr2rpayr2N7bRjvCJWZfnC5v